Surrey County Council Home from Hospital Support Services - Contract Award

Decision Maker: Cabinet

Decision status: Recommendations Approved

Is Key decision?: Yes

Is subject to call in?: Yes

Purpose:

To approve the award of a new contract for Home from Hospital service from every acute hospital across the county for adults living in Surrey who are ready to be discharged home and require short term support with daily skill / tasks.

Decision:

RESOLVED:

 

  1. That the contracts be awarded for one year, from 1 October 2016 with an option to extend for two further periods of one year each.

·        Red Cross – Lot 3 East Surrey.

·        Home Group Limited – Lot 1 Northwest Surrey,  Lot 2 Surrey Downs, Lot 4 Guildford and Waverley, Lot 5 Surrey Heath, North East Hampshire and Farnham.

 

  1. That the combined annual contract value of the two contracts awarded be £335,000.00 (£1,005,000.00 including extension periods).

 

Reasons for decisions

 

The existing grant agreement, which is funded from the Better Care Fund, will expire on 30 September 2016.  There is a continuing need for a service to support individuals who are ready to be discharged from hospital and return home with short term support. This service has contributed towards a reduction in hospital readmissions and gives confidence to individuals to continue living at home. This tender exercise was conducted in compliance with procurement legislation and Procurement Standing Orders. The recommendations provide best value for money for the Council and the Clinical Commissioning Groups.
